According to a new study by 24/7 Wall St. Louisiana has landed at number 5 in lowest median family incomes in the United States.

The study adjusted for each state's cost of living and other major factors. The household income range in Louisiana for a family to be considered middle income is $22,916 to $112,915.

Below is a list of states ranked highest to lowest in the 24/7 Wall St. study. Looks like Massachusetts got the over-all highest household income on the list. And, our neighbor Mississippi scored the over-all lowest. Louisiana didn't do much better than dead last. Earning just over 4 grand more than Mississippi.

10 States with the Lowest Median Family Income

  1. Mississippi -- $57,380
  2. West Virginia -- $57,718
  3. Arkansas -- $58,080
  4. New Mexico -- $58,760
  5. Louisiana -- $61,847
  6. Kentucky -- $62,228
  7. Alabama -- $63,837
  8. Oklahoma -- $64,082
  9. Tennessee -- $65,656
  10. South Carolina -- $65,742

10 States with the Highest Median Family Income

  1. Massachusetts -- $101,548
  2. Maryland -- $101,437
  3. New Jersey -- $101,404
  4. Connecticut -- $98,100
  5. Hawaii -- $95,448
  6. New Hampshire -- $93,930
  7. Alaska -- $89,847
  8. Minnesota -- $89,039
  9. Colorado -- $88,955
  10. Virginia -- $88,929
